The Logitech G432 is a wired gaming headset designed to deliver a solid audio experience with its large 50mm drivers and DTS Headphone:X 2.0 surround sound, which helps create clear and immersive positional audio—great for gaming where hearing direction matters. The microphone is a 6mm flip-to-mute type, making it convenient to quickly mute when needed, and it includes volume controls on the cable for easy adjustments.
Comfort-wise, the G432 uses premium leatherette ear pads and a matching headband, which should feel soft and comfortable during longer gaming sessions, though leatherette can sometimes cause warmth over extended use. Its over-ear design helps with noise isolation but might not suit everyone’s fit preferences. Connectivity is straightforward with a 3.5mm jack plus a USB DAC, allowing use with PC, consoles like PS4 and Xbox One, and mobile devices, making it quite versatile. Being wired means you avoid battery concerns but also limits movement compared to wireless models. The 6.5-foot cable provides good length for most setups but isn’t retractable as sometimes claimed.
Durability isn’t highlighted as a strong point; while Logitech generally makes reliable gear, faux leather materials can wear over time, and wired headsets can be prone to cable damage if not handled carefully. Additional features focus on gaming needs, such as the surround sound tech and convenient mic mute, but lack extra bells like active noise cancellation or customizable RGB lighting. This headset is a good choice for gamers looking for immersive sound, simple controls, and multi-platform compatibility in a comfortable wired headset. It may not have premium build materials or wireless freedom, but it offers strong value for those prioritizing clear in-game audio and voice chat.
The Logitech G733 Lightspeed Wireless Gaming Headset stands out with its impressive wireless range of up to 20 meters and a substantial battery life of up to 29 hours, making it ideal for lengthy gaming sessions. This headset features PRO-G audio drivers, which are designed to deliver clear and rich sound quality, perfect for gaming enthusiasts who need to hear detailed audio cues. The inclusion of advanced mic filters with Blue VO!CE technology ensures that your voice sounds richer and more professional, which is beneficial for streaming and communication during gameplay.
Comfort is a priority with the G733, thanks to its suspension headband and soft dual-layer memory foam that reduces stress points, allowing for extended use without discomfort. Additionally, the headset offers customizable RGB lighting, adding a personalized touch to your gaming setup. Connectivity is seamless with compatibility across various consoles like P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, and Nintendo Switch, albeit with stereo sound only via USB wireless dongle.
The headset is primarily designed for over-the-ear placement, which might not suit everyone's preference. The G733 is lightweight at 9.8 ounces, enhancing its comfort further, but its plastic build may raise concerns about its long-term durability. The headset does not feature active noise control, which could be a drawback for users in noisy environments. Despite these minor shortcomings, the Logitech G733 offers a strong combination of sound quality, comfort, and battery life, making it well-suited for gamers seeking a reliable and customizable wireless headset.
The Logitech G435 LIGHTSPEED Wireless Bluetooth Gaming Headset offers a lightweight and versatile option for gamers across several platforms like PC, PlayStation, Nintendo Switch, and mobile devices. Weighing just 5.8 ounces, it’s comfortable enough for long gaming sessions, especially for younger or smaller head sizes thanks to memory foam ear cushions. The headset delivers good sound quality with 40 mm drivers and supports immersive surround sound technologies like Dolby Atmos and Tempest 3D, enhancing game audio experiences.
Microphone quality is solid for casual gaming, using dual built-in beamforming mics that reduce background noise without needing a bulky mic arm. Connectivity is a highlight, as it combines Logitech’s low-latency LIGHTSPEED wireless with Bluetooth 5.2, providing flexibility and stable connections. Battery life impresses with up to 18 hours per charge, allowing extended play without frequent recharging.
The headset lacks active noise cancellation and isn’t water resistant, which means it might pick up some outside noise and requires some care to avoid damage. Durability is decent for its plastic build, including 22% recycled materials, but it may not withstand heavy rough use over time. Additional perks include a volume limiter to protect your ears and eco-friendly packaging. This headset is a strong choice if you want a lightweight, wireless gaming headset with solid sound and mic quality for everyday gaming across multiple devices, though if premium noise isolation or a super rugged build are priorities, other options might be better.
